Subject: [PATCH] MIPS: pci: lantiq: Use devm_platform_get_and_ioremap_resource()
Date: Wed, 8 Feb 2023 10:46:39 +0800 (CST) [thread overview]
Message-ID: <202302081046390773649@zte.com.cn> (raw)
From: Ye Xingchen <ye.xingchen@zte.com.cn>
Convert platform_get_resource(), devm_ioremap_resource() to a single
call to devm_platform_get_and_ioremap_resource(), as this is exactly
what this function does.
Signed-off-by: Ye Xingchen <ye.xingchen@zte.com.cn>
---
arch/mips/pci/pci-lantiq.c | 8 ++------
1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 6 deletions(-)
diff --git a/arch/mips/pci/pci-lantiq.c b/arch/mips/pci/pci-lantiq.c
index 8d16cd021f60..d967e4c0cf24 100644
--- a/arch/mips/pci/pci-lantiq.c
+++ b/arch/mips/pci/pci-lantiq.c
@@ -204,17 +204,13 @@ static int ltq_pci_startup(struct platform_device *pdev)
static int ltq_pci_probe(struct platform_device *pdev)
{
- struct resource *res_cfg, *res_bridge;
-
pci_clear_flags(PCI_PROBE_ONLY);
- res_bridge = platform_get_resource(pdev, IORESOURCE_MEM, 1);
- ltq_pci_membase = devm_ioremap_resource(&pdev->dev, res_bridge);
+ ltq_pci_membase = devm_platform_get_and_ioremap_resource(pdev, 1, NULL);
if (IS_ERR(ltq_pci_membase))
return PTR_ERR(ltq_pci_membase);
- res_cfg = platform_get_resource(pdev, IORESOURCE_MEM, 0);
- ltq_pci_mapped_cfg = devm_ioremap_resource(&pdev->dev, res_cfg);
+ ltq_pci_mapped_cfg = devm_platform_get_and_ioremap_resource(pdev, 0, NULL);
if (IS_ERR(ltq_pci_mapped_cfg))
return PTR_ERR(ltq_pci_mapped_cfg);
